Senior Animation TD

That’s No Moon is an independent AAA game development studio established in 2021 by veterans of some of the most recognizable and critically acclaimed creative teams in the world, including Naughty Dog, Infinity Ward, Santa Monica Studio, Bungie, PlayStation, and more. A remote-friendly studio with a central office and performance capture stage located in Los Angeles, That’s No Moon is creating the next generation of narrative-driven, genre-defining experiences built upon a culture of creativity, collaboration, responsible production practices, and individual empowerment. We are looking for a Senior Technical Artist specializing in animation production to help build and maintain an efficient pipeline to facilitate both cinematic and gameplay animation into the engine. You will work with hardworking animators and engineers to push the quality and fidelity for next-gen game animation and enable the artists to do their best work.
Responsibilities:
- Support both gameplay and cinematic animation pipelines from performance acquisition across multiple DCC software packages into engine
- Create DCC and Editor tools to streamline animation authoring workflow and improve efficiency while reducing human errors
- Create easy to use tools to empower artists to “make art”
- Work closely with engineering, design, and animation to support creating contents for in-game blend tree and/or motion matching setups
- Work with rigging team and engineers to develop runtime animation features
- Collaborate with other TDs to build a cohesive studio codebase
- Troubleshoot animation issues in game as well as in DCC apps.
- Build/Maintain relevant usage documentation
Requirements & Skills:
- (Required) 5+ years of professional experience as animation TD or tech animator in game, film, or other relevant industries
- (Required) Maya Expertise in areas of animation
- (Required) Strong Python experience in the areas of tools and UI (e.g., PyQt) and Maya Scripting
- (Preferred) Understanding of gameplay and cinematic animation workflows
- (Preferred) Degree in animation or related art and/or technical field
- (Preferred) Experience working with MoCap data
- (Preferred) Experience working with UnrealEngine, Unity, or similar game engine
- (Preferred) Motion Builder and API Experience
- (Bonus) Motion Matching experience and knowledge
- (Bonus) Maya API / Plugin Experience
- (Bonus) Familiarity with Unreal Virtual Production
